Before discussing global players, one must acknowledge the 800-pound gorilla: . Launched by the Saudi-owned MBC group, Shahid is often called the "Arab Netflix," but that undersells it. In terms of local penetration and content volume, Shahid rivals global streamers on their home turf. It holds the rights to the vast majority of classic Arab cinema and produces original series that blend local social issues with premium production values.

Ramadan has historically been, and remains, the peak season for television. Families gather daily for musalsalat —high-drama soap operas spanning 30 episodes, tackling family dynamics, social taboos, and historical epics.
